It leads to the return of a lot of great things from our childhoods (or thereabouts). Ecto-Cooler is coming back, amongst other things. Anovos is bringing us something that we didn’t have back in the 80’s but would have killed for. A build-it-yourself Proton Pack that looks absolutely amazing.

While it’s easy enough to build yourself, it’s probably not going to be something your seven-year-old could do by himself, especially considering the ABS and fiberglass bits have to be attached to the main base of the contraption.

Proton_Pack_06_grande

 

Please note that the light and sound electronics package featuring movie sound effects will be sold seperately. We know that’s a biggie for you.

Once you look at the fully constructed product, it really does look like the film version. It will make the perfect accessory to bring with you to the movie premiere or your next pop culture convention. The only problem? It’ll run you $600 and they don’t ship until November, so Halloween is unfortunately out of the question.

Christmas, however, is fair game. Heat’m up.
